The Undeniable Importance of Quality Edge Trim for Wall Cabinets
Wall cabinets, whether in kitchens, bathrooms, offices, or living spaces, are high-traffic items subjected to daily wear and tear, moisture, and impact. The raw edges of their panels, typically made from particleboard, MDF (Medium-Density Fiberboard), or plywood, are vulnerable. This is where edge trim profiles become indispensable.
1. Structural Protection: The primary function of edge trim is to seal and protect the vulnerable core material of the cabinet panel. Raw particleboard or MDF edges can easily chip, swell from moisture absorption (especially critical in kitchen and bathroom environments), and degrade over time. A robust edge trim acts as a barrier against spills, humidity, and physical knocks, significantly extending the cabinet's lifespan.
2. Aesthetic Enhancement: Beyond protection, edge trims are crucial for the visual appeal of wall cabinets. They cover unsightly raw edges, providing a clean, finished look that integrates seamlessly with the cabinet's surface material. Whether it's a perfectly matched wood grain, a contrasting solid color, or a metallic accent, the right edge trim elevates the overall design, making the cabinet appear more premium and thoughtfully constructed.
3. Hygiene and Cleanliness: Unsealed edges can harbor dirt, dust, and grime, making cleaning difficult and potentially compromising hygiene, particularly in kitchens. A smooth, properly applied edge trim creates a continuous, easy-to-wipe surface, contributing to a cleaner and healthier environment.
4. User Safety: Sharp, unfinished edges can pose a safety hazard, leading to cuts or scrapes. Edge trims smooth out these edges, making cabinet doors, shelves, and frames safer to handle and interact with daily.

Understanding Wall Cabinet Edge Trim Profiles: A Factory Perspective
The term "buckle strip" (扣条) often refers to a more rigid, perhaps decorative or functional, profile designed to protect and finish edges. This distinguishes it from standard thin PVC edge banding tape. From our factory's viewpoint, we manufacture a diverse range of materials and profiles to meet these varied needs:
Materials We Master
PVC (Polyvinyl Chloride): The most common and versatile material for edge banding. PVC offers excellent durability, moisture resistance, flexibility, and a vast array of colors and finishes, including realistic wood grains, high gloss, and matte options. It's cost-effective and easy to process.
ABS (Acrylonitrile Butadiene Styrene): A more environmentally friendly alternative to PVC, ABS is halogen-free and recyclable. It offers similar properties to PVC in terms of durability and aesthetic versatility but is slightly more rigid and often preferred for applications requiring higher impact resistance or specific environmental certifications.
PP (Polypropylene): Another eco-friendly option, PP is known for its excellent flexibility, chemical resistance, and non-toxic properties. It's often chosen for applications where a softer touch or specific chemical inertness is required, though less common for rigid decorative profiles.
Acrylic (PMMA): Used for creating stunning 3D or "glass effect" edge bands. Acrylic edge banding features a solid color core with a transparent top layer, giving a sophisticated, luminous look, especially popular with high-gloss panels.
Aluminum & Metal-Look Profiles: When "扣条" implies a truly rigid, often metallic, trim, we produce or extrude profiles made from aluminum or create highly realistic metal-look PVC/ABS profiles. These are often used for contemporary designs, high-wear areas, or specific decorative accents on wall cabinets.
Types of Profiles (Beyond Flat Tape)
The "buckle strip" concept often points towards more structured profiles:
T-Molding: Features a "T" shaped cross-section with a barb that fits into a routed groove on the panel edge. Offers excellent impact protection and a distinct look. Ideal for more robust applications.
U-Profiles / C-Profiles: Designed to cap the entire edge, wrapping around it. Can be glued or sometimes designed for a friction fit. Excellent for protecting delicate edges or creating a visual frame.
J-Profiles / L-Profiles: Often used as handles or decorative elements on cabinet doors and drawer fronts, these profiles offer a clean, integrated look while serving a functional purpose.
Snap-on / Clip-on Profiles: These are specifically engineered with internal clips or mechanisms to securely fasten onto a panel edge without the need for adhesives, making installation and replacement simpler.
Decorative Lip Profiles: Designed to extend slightly beyond the panel surface, creating a subtle visual break or a finger pull edge.

The Installation Process: A Step-by-Step Guide for Wall Cabinet Edge Trim
While an installation video provides visual clarity, understanding the underlying principles and steps is crucial. This guide covers general best practices for various edge trim types, with specific notes for the more rigid "buckle strip" or profile types.
Phase 1: Meticulous Preparation – The Foundation of Success
Poor preparation is the leading cause of installation failure. Do not skip this phase.
Tools and Materials:
Measuring tape and pencil
Panel saw or specialized cutter (for straight cuts)
Miter saw (for precise corner cuts on profiles)
Router with appropriate bit (for T-molding grooves or flush trimming)
Edge banding machine (for high-volume tape application) or manual edge trimmer
Adhesive applicator (for glue-on profiles: glue gun, roller, or spreader)
Contact adhesive, hot-melt adhesive, or specialized glues (ensure compatibility with materials)
Clamps, pressure rollers, or specialized pressing tools
Clean cloths, denatured alcohol or panel cleaner
Safety glasses and gloves
Cabinet Panel Surface Preparation:
Cleanliness: The edge of the cabinet panel must be absolutely clean, dry, and free from dust, grease, oil, or any contaminants. Use a clean cloth and a suitable panel cleaner if necessary.
Smoothness: Ensure the panel edge is perfectly smooth and flat. Any bumps, divots, or irregularities will translate directly through the edge trim, creating gaps or an uneven finish. Use a sanding block if needed, but be careful not to round the edges excessively.
Squareness: For optimal adhesion and a flush finish, the panel edge should be perfectly square (90 degrees) to the surface.
Measuring and Cutting the Edge Trim:
Measure Precisely: Measure the length of the cabinet edge to be covered.
Allow for Overhang (if applicable): For standard edge banding tape applied with an edge bander, always cut the tape slightly longer than the panel to allow for trimming flush later. For rigid profiles, measure precisely and cut to exact length.
Corner Cuts (Critical for "Buckle Strips"): For profiles that meet at corners, precise miter cuts (typically 45 degrees) are essential for a seamless joint. A miter saw offers the best accuracy. Dry-fit corners before applying adhesive to ensure a perfect match.
Groove Routing (for T-Molding): If using T-molding or similar profiles, use a router with a specialized slotting bit to create a perfectly centered groove along the panel edge. The groove's width and depth must match the T-molding's barb dimensions exactly.
Phase 2: Application – Bringing the Trim to Life
This phase varies significantly based on the type of edge trim profile.
Standard Edge Banding Tape (Hot-Melt or Contact Adhesive):
Manual Application: Apply a thin, even layer of contact adhesive to both the panel edge and the back of the edge band. Allow it to become tacky according to adhesive instructions. Carefully align the edge band and press firmly along its entire length.
Edge Bander Machine: For high-volume production, an edge banding machine applies hot-melt glue, presses the edge band onto the panel, and trims it automatically. This offers superior consistency and efficiency.
Pressure: Apply consistent, firm pressure immediately after placing the edge band. Use a rubber roller or pressure block to ensure maximum adhesion and remove air bubbles.
Rigid Profiles (e.g., U-Profiles, L-Profiles, Decorative Strips - "扣条"):
Adhesive Application: For glue-on profiles, apply a compatible adhesive (e.g., contact cement, construction adhesive, or specialized plastic/metal glue) to the inner surfaces of the profile and/or the panel edge. Ensure even coverage but avoid excessive glue that might squeeze out.
Placement and Alignment: Carefully position the profile onto the cabinet edge. Take your time to ensure perfect alignment, especially if it needs to wrap around the entire edge or meet other profiles at corners.
Clamping/Pressure: Use clamps, painter's tape, or specialized jigs to hold the profile firmly in place while the adhesive cures. Consistent pressure is key to preventing gaps.
T-Molding Application (Groove-Fitting Profiles):
Dry Fit: Always dry-fit the T-molding into the routed groove first to ensure a snug fit. The barb should enter the groove with firm but not excessive force.
Adhesive (Optional but Recommended): For added security, a thin bead of wood glue or construction adhesive can be applied into the groove before inserting the T-molding. This helps prevent future loosening.
Insertion: Carefully tap the T-molding into the groove using a rubber mallet. Work along the entire length, ensuring the barb is fully seated and the top of the T-molding is flush with the cabinet surface.
Snap-on / Clip-on Profiles ("扣条" specific):
Alignment: Align the profile's clips or internal mechanisms with the cabinet edge.
Press and Snap: Apply firm, even pressure along the length of the profile until you hear or feel it "snap" into place. Ensure all clips are engaged for a secure fit. These are designed for ease of installation and often do not require adhesive, though some may recommend it for specific applications.
Phase 3: Finishing Touches – The Mark of a Professional
Trimming Excess: For standard edge banding, use a flush trim router bit or a manual edge trimmer to remove any overhang, ensuring the edge band is perfectly flush with the cabinet surface. Be careful not to damage the panel surface.
Cleaning: Immediately wipe away any excess adhesive squeeze-out using a damp cloth or a solvent recommended by the adhesive manufacturer. Once cured, some adhesives are very difficult to remove.
Sanding/Buffing (Optional): For some plastic edge bands, a light buffing might be done to remove any minor scuffs from trimming. For wood edge banding, a fine sanding can create a perfectly smooth transition.
Inspection: Thoroughly inspect the installed edge trim for any gaps, lifted sections, or inconsistencies. Address any issues promptly before the adhesive fully cures.
Common Installation Challenges & Troubleshooting from Our Experience
Even with the best materials, installation issues can arise. Here's what we've seen and how to tackle it:
Gaps or Lifting:
Cause: Insufficient adhesive, poor surface preparation, uneven pressure during application, incorrect adhesive type, or too little pressure during clamping.
Solution: Ensure surfaces are clean and dry. Apply adequate, even adhesive. Use consistent, firm pressure. For lifting, reapply adhesive to the affected area and clamp until dry.
Rough or Uneven Edges After Trimming:
Cause: Dull trimmer blades, incorrect router bit depth, or uneven pressure during trimming.
Solution: Use sharp tools. Ensure router bit depth is set correctly. Practice on scrap pieces.
Visible Glue Lines:
Cause: Too much adhesive applied, or adhesive that's not color-matched or dries clear.
Solution: Apply adhesive sparingly and evenly. Use clear-drying adhesives or those specifically designed for edge banding. Clean excess immediately.
Poor Corner Joints for Profiles:
Cause: Inaccurate miter cuts, material stretching, or insufficient clamping.
Solution: Use a precise miter saw. Dry-fit and adjust before final application. Ensure corners are tightly clamped or taped while adhesive cures.
T-Molding Not Seating Properly:
Cause: Groove is too narrow, too shallow, or off-center; T-molding barb is too thick.
Solution: Ensure router bit matches T-molding barb dimensions. Test fit before applying. Re-route the groove if necessary.
